Grasping Independent AI


Autonomous AI describes technologies that possess the capability to function on their own and decide according to their context and goals. Unlike traditional AI, which is grounded in preset algorithms and human intervention, agentic AI employs advanced algorithms that allow it to gain knowledge from experience and modify its behavior over time.
